mum, mam, mom all may be used like Craig said. two more things. 1. Mum as a proper word means silent. 2. do not confuse mam with ma´am which is an abbreviation of madam.

In the states, we mostly say "mom," which is like "mah-m". Or "Mommy". I always thought it sounded strange to hear British people say "mum," but like Aseer says, that might sound like "ma'ame," depending on one's pronunciation.
